(Vanhoefen’s lanternfish)

references general statements on the distribution of this species: o Hulley (1981): …restricted to regions…within the Mauritanian Upwelling and Guinean Regions of the Atlantic, with…a southern limit at about 15°S off the African coast… Two male specimens (31,40-32,55 mm)

were taken from a stomach of a hake caught off the La Plata River mouth (WH 424/66)…

o Fricke et al. (2024): Atlantic

EEZ-UY references o none specimens ZMH collection:

o 104978 424/66 Krefft status First record for EEZ-UY.
